Google may soon let Gemini explain anything on your screen… without circling it

A smarter, screen-savvy Gemini could turn every gesture into an instant explanation, and make traditional visual search feel outdated.

What’s happened? Google is reportedly working on a new Gemini tool (reportedly called “Circle Screen”) that can analyze your phone’s screen and automatically explain or summarize it.

  • The tool may effectively replace one of the most popular and celebrated AI-based features on smartphones: Circle to Search (via Android Authority).
  • Google’s new screen-understanding tool lets you ask Gemini about whatever appears on your phone’s display, including text, images, and mathematical formulas, among other things.

Why is this important? Currently, users have to invoke the Circle to Search tool, highlight a portion of the screen, then receive relevant responses and the opportunity to ask follow-up queries.

  • However, the new update builds on the gesture-based interface and extends it.
  • Instead of launching a search, Gemini now interprets the selection and produces AI-based summaries or explanations.
  • It marks a shift from simple visual search to an AI-powered experience in which your phone provides more details about what you see without invoking Circle to Search and switching interfaces.

Why should I care? The addition comes as part of Google’s broader effort to integrate Gemini across most touchpoints in Android (and even Wear OS).

  • The new Gemini tool could streamline how we consume information on smartphones, eliminating the need to copy/paste, switching apps, or using the Circle to Search tool.
  • For example, imagine reading a social-media post in another language and instantly getting a translation or explanation on the screen with a gesture, without leaving the app.
  • Students or researchers could take a screenshot of a diagram, quote, or paragraph and ask Gemini to summarize or explain it.

OK, what’s next? We should expect more Android phones, not just the high-end flagships or Pixel devices, to get this Gemini-powered screen-analysis feature.

  • Over time, this could change how we use Gemini, as they could get an AI explanation with a single gesture.
  • However, the feature also raises questions about privacy and UX control as devices become better at understanding what’s on your screen.
  • Most recently, Google was spotted integrating AI Mode to Circle to Search for providing answers to follow-up queries.
